Space Refugee is a sculpture which tells the story of a father and his daugther who can travel in time and space using a huge magic lollipop while riding a big skippy ball.
It's an adventure of a survivor of torture and war who managed to turn his trauma into a superpower with the essential help of his 7-year old little girl. The story of Omar Imam is very personal, but it's also a tribute to all the fathers who are carrying their children on their backs and escape war. It's for all the survivors.

These 'Fragments' are located at his Sculpture garden in Stellenbosch (South Africa). Lewis’s primary inspiration is the wilderness. At one level the sculptures celebrate the power and movement of Africa’s life forms; at another the textures he creates speak of the continent’s primaeval, rugged landscapes and their ancient rhythms.
